Transaction 5102f528a63d00ca1a5c655a0498bd2c7c35bbdce88e6510b94031f6c1c5cc7e

1 Input
2 Outputs
  • 5102f528a63d00ca1a5c655a0498bd2c7c35bbdce88e6510b94031f6c1c5cc7e:0
  • value  2982219
    address  1FhYY3iT5vAcYA4Gj9r8SDgcT6Qd2hzxP5
  • 5102f528a63d00ca1a5c655a0498bd2c7c35bbdce88e6510b94031f6c1c5cc7e:1
  • value  18431000
    address  12djfp9eJCdskbgMZ7EGTQj38Bvzuubb6X